Collection of autograph letters signed : various places, to varous recipients, 1728-1777 and undated.

Collection consists of four letters from Voltaire to an undientified woman, Chevalier d'Eon, M. Delaleu, and Madame Crammer, as well as one letter (MA 369.5) written from Maturin Veyssière a La Croze, written on behalf of the Queen of Prussia. With two engraved portraits (MA 639.6-7). Letters have been cataloged individually in five separate records; see related records for more information.

1 v. (7 items), bound ; 22.8 cm.
